Checklist
- Confirm the exact configuration in writing before the deposit is paid.
- Record the arrival condition with photographs on the day of delivery.
- Log sell through by account for the first eight weeks.
- Check carton quantities against the commercial invoice line by line.
- Agree in advance who pays for return freight on a defect claim.
- Keep certificates current and filed against the exact model name.

Frequently asked questions
Who is responsible for Rexa Plus label compliance?
Responsibility sits with the importer of record, though good suppliers supply compliant artwork templates.
How quickly can a repeat order be produced?
For established configurations production typically runs two to four weeks, with transit on top depending on the chosen method.
Is documentation provided for customs?
Commercial invoice, packing list and the relevant certificates are supplied; the importer's broker handles the declaration.
Can packaging be adjusted for our market?
Artwork localisation is straightforward; structural changes need larger volumes and a longer lead time.
